What is a customer service fulfillment associate?

Customer Service Fulfillment Associates are professionals responsible for processing and managing customer orders, handling inquiries, and ensuring timely delivery of products or services. They act as a bridge between customers and the company, addressing any issues related to orders, shipping, and returns. Their role often involves using inventory management systems, coordinating with warehouses, and maintaining accurate records to ensure customer satisfaction. Strong communication and organizational skills are essential for success in this position.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a customer service fulfillment associate?

To thrive as a Customer Service Fulfillment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ience in order processing or inventory management,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with order management systems, warehouse software, and basic office tools like spreadsheets is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and teamwork abilities help you deliver exceptional service and resolve customer issues efficiently. These skills are essential to ensure accurate order fulfillment, customer satisfaction, and smooth workflow operations.

How does a customer service fulfillment associate typically collaborate with other departments to resolve customer issues?

Customer Service Fulfillment Associates frequently work closely with warehouse, logistics, and inventory management teams to resolve order-related concerns. When a customer reports a problem, such as a delayed shipment or incorrect item, associates coordinate with these departments to investigate and expedite solutions. Effective communication and teamwork are crucial, as associates must relay accurate information between customers and internal teams. This collaborative approach ensures customer satisfaction and smooth order fulfillment.

Fulfillment Associate I

The Fulfillment Associate I is responsible for performing a variety of tasks focusing on fulfilling orders within a specific ship window, while ensuring accuracy through Quality Control measures. The Fulfillment Associate I position is an entry level position into the organization with an emphasis on training across all aspects of fulfillment. This position requires some repeated heavy lifting (up to 50 lbs) throughout the day, carrying and lifting while reaching, bending, climbing, walking, and standing to move product throughout the warehouse. He or she will operate light and heavy warehouse equipment as needed for picking, packing and shipping.

Responsibilities
  • Assist in fulfillment process by Picking, Packing, and Labeling inventory to fill sales orders as instructed by team leads and other management.
  • Prepare, organize, and process orders with a high level of accuracy. Fulfill and organize orders to ensure the shipping process is efficient and accurate.
  • Communicate with team lead to rectify problems such as damages, shortages, irregular specifications of product or noncompliance.
  • Ensure stable packing of product to minimize damages, or fall-over, by following routing guidelines and stage shipment in designated areas directed by team leads.
  • Record shipment data such as pallet count, carton count, height, and weight to aid in shipment routing.
  • Move or load materials using light and heavy duty work devices such as conveyors, hand trucks, forklifts, ride on pallet jacks, or pallet jacks.
  • Comply with company regulations by following all quality assurance standards, including good housekeeping and overall cleanliness of products and work areas.
  • Maintain readiness of all distribution equipment and materials (forklifts, pallet jacks, hand trucks, conveyor systems, tape guns, box knives, etc.) including regular cleaning and user maintenance.
  • Must be able to work overtime when necessary and be able to participate in physical inventory counts.
  • Store shipping materials and supplies. Notify team lead of stock levels.
Qualifications
  • Forklift experience preferred but not mandatory.
  • High school diploma or GED or equivalent work experience in warehousing, distribution, fulfillment.
  • Ability to read and understand the English language for the purpose of comparing and reading product descriptions, names and shelf labels.
  • Ability to use good judgment in order to carry out detailed instructions.
  • Must possess basic math skills
